The Turtle Ships!




They are old warships used a few centuries ago, engineered by a great general. There weren't very many, but they were very smart boats. lots of spikes on the top of the turtle ship prevented people from jumping aboard, and the oars were built to move along with the sides of the ship instead of sticking out, so that way they would be more protected.
